Overview

Join the RAC as a Mobile Mechanic in the Service, Maintenance and Repair division. You’ll bring expert vehicle maintenance and diagnostic skills directly to our customers, wherever they are—driveways, office car parks, and beyond. You’ll work with independence, supported by a provided RAC van, fuel card, full uniform, essential tools, and diagnostic kit. We’re looking for practical mechanics who value progress powered by people and a commitment to excellent customer service.

Responsibilities
  • Deliver first-class vehicle maintenance, diagnostics, and repairs at customer locations.
  • Provide strong customer conversations, advice, and representation of the RAC with pride.
  • Manage stock, reporting, and maintain clear, ongoing communication with customers.
  • Think on your feet to determine the right approach for each customer and situation.
  • Travel to customer sites with a focus on safety, quality, and efficiency.
Qualifications
  • Level 2 light vehicle maintenance qualification (or equivalent).
  • At least 3 years’ hands-on experience as a vehicle technician working with a range of light vehicles.
  • A full UK driving licence with fewer than 6 points.
Location and Compensation
  • Bournemouth, Dorset – Up to £50k per annum (Full Time).
  • A competitive base salary of £38,625, with on-target earnings up to £50,000.
  • Guaranteed overtime option to increase base salary to £44,385, plus additional overtime and bonus opportunities.
  • 40 hours per week, core hours 8:30am–5pm, and 1 in 4 Saturdays.
What’s Included to Help You Succeed
  • Tools to Drive Your Future: RAC van, fuel card, full uniform, essential tools, and diagnostic kit provided.
  • Time Off and Wellbeing: 23 days of holiday (rising to 25 with service), bank holidays, paid family leave, flexible schedules, and access to wellbeing resources.
  • Financial Security and Perks: pension scheme (up to 6.5% matched), life assurance up to 4x salary (10x optional with flex benefits), and access to exclusive discounts.
  • Extras:
    Orange Savings discounts, Colleague Share Scheme after probation, and a car salary sacrifice scheme (including EV options) after 12 months.
